Output 258ad266979321aa2facefeedf54112c889dd0272a875868b7006e97fffda44e:1

value
20684
script pubkey
OP_0 OP_PUSHBYTES_20 abc3ada68c0a94edf1cbce952e4dab70b373341b
address
bc1q40p6mf5vp22wmuwte62jundtwzehxdqmeqvg5l
transaction
258ad266979321aa2facefeedf54112c889dd0272a875868b7006e97fffda44e